I also noticed the system is a bit more unstable when c2w patcher is running and crashes are frequent (especially if I open and close several homebrew apps without rebooting) so I want to be sure I'm the one launching it.
But the patches get applied while loading the Wii forwarder, not before. So far there are 0 reports about instability caused by the aroma c2w_patcher plugins and it hasn't been released yesterday.

Aroma actually gives you more stability with such things than any CFW before.

Lastly, I don't want stuff to run at boot by pressing a button
Then just don't do it? Why would you need to press any button while booting Aroma? It's automatic coldboot, just like Tiramisu. In fact Tiramisu supports exactly the same boot buttons things than Aroma. Well not true, Tiramisu has even more possible buttons to press than Aroma, so with Tiramisu you need to remember more buttons in case you really need that (which I highly doubt).
